Transaction 28390c2138ccedf24efef20077b21303e7f71eb9de1ad58e2c93c655d1e6fe2f

2 Input
2 Outputs
  • 28390c2138ccedf24efef20077b21303e7f71eb9de1ad58e2c93c655d1e6fe2f:0
  • value  2055259
    address  14BzFC6ACn5KMLgtikL1QQaxe5CVuuf2FE
  • 28390c2138ccedf24efef20077b21303e7f71eb9de1ad58e2c93c655d1e6fe2f:1
  • value  59958
    address  16ZE8KCEAznTnbtcJs4YNTyBntw687rZ78